All-terrain

All-terrain prams are a great option if you like exploring off the beaten path or are in rural areas, or want to run with your child. The best all-terrain prams will feature large, sturdy wheels that can withstand bumpy ground and great suspension to make your journey comfortable for your baby.

They're typically bigger than standard pushchairs and could be heavy to store in your car boot. They are also more expensive than other pushchairs. Be aware of this as you shop for a new one.

You should choose one that has adjustable height bars. This will be helpful when you and/or your companion have different heights. You should also consider whether you'd like a wrist strap, which reduces the risk of it rolling away on sloping ground or going over hills. Some models are designed with an incline front wheel fixed, which is easier to control if intend to use it for jogging. Some models have a swivel front wheel that can be locked in place to allow you to maneuver on uneven surfaces.

The type of tyre you choose is equally important. Many all-terrain pushchairs use air-filled tyres that provide a smooth ride but can puncture easily. Some models have an inflated tyre that is filled with gel or foam which are less likely to puncture but will add extra weight to the pushchair.

A great all-terrain stroller should include a large, spacious basket that can be used to carry your baby's food. Some come with a compact 3 wheel stroller one-handed fold that allows for easy storage when not in use. They will often have a raincover and footmuff included too.

Folding

Many of the most well-known pushchairs are folding models. They take up less space in your home and are more convenient to put in the trunk of your car and are ideal when you're in a tight space, have a small 3 wheel stroller car boot or are planning to travel a lot as families.

There are many different fold styles, so you need to look for one that fits your lifestyle and needs. The latest models of buggy have an auto-fold feature that can be folded in a matter of a push of a single button. This frees your hands to carry a baby bags, or other children and is perfect for parents with back problems or recovering from C-sections.

Other models are designed to fold more conventionally with the seat on, so they'll weigh a bit more and may not fit as snugly in your car boot. Some models will require two hands or more to fold. This could pose a problem for parents who wish to hold their child while folding.

It doesn't matter if you prefer an easy umbrella fold or a more complex mechanism, you should ensure that the stroller you select will be able to cope with the terrain you'll be riding it on. For instance, if you'll be navigating lots of cobblestones and gravel tracks, then ensure that the wheels are made of air-filled tyres that will provide the most comfortable ride for your child.

If you'll be using your pushchair mainly on pavements and paved roads the majority of three-wheelers have moulded wheels which will ensure your child has a smooth ride.
